Introduction to Forevermark Cabinets

Forevermark Cabinets have become a popular choice among homeowners, interior designers, and contractors for their balance of affordability, durability, and style. Manufactured by The Shekia Group (TSG), Forevermark offers a wide variety of cabinet styles, colors, and finishes that suit both traditional and modern kitchens. Aside from their aesthetic appeal, these cabinets are also known for their solid wood construction, environmentally friendly coatings, and industry certifications.

Understanding the Forevermark Distribution Model

Forevermark Cabinets are not sold directly by the manufacturer to end consumers. Instead, they are distributed through a nationwide network of authorized dealers, which includes both physical showroom retailers and online-only businesses. This hybrid distribution model allows Forevermark to maintain a consistent product line while offering customers various ways to shop.

The company carefully selects its authorized dealers, ensuring they meet standards related to customer service, cabinetry knowledge, and product handling. These partners can be found in local communities or operate strictly via e-commerce platforms. This flexibility provides buyers with more options, but it also introduces differences in pricing, availability, and support.

While some buyers prefer the convenience of online shopping, others may value the tactile experience of viewing cabinets in person. Forevermark’s dual-channel approach aims to satisfy both preferences.

Comparing Price Points: Showrooms vs. Online Retailers

When comparing local showrooms and online retailers, one of the biggest considerations for buyers is cost. The price of Forevermark Cabinets can vary depending on the dealer’s pricing structure, location, and whether or not installation services are included.

Key Pricing Differences:

  • Showroom Prices: Typically include design consultation, delivery, and potential installation. These added services can drive up the price but may provide added value.

  • Online Prices: Often more affordable on the surface due to lack of in-person services. However, shipping costs and the need to hire a separate contractor may balance out the initial savings.

Buyers should carefully review quotes and factor in all services when making a cost comparison. A lower price online may not include professional design or post-sale support, which are typically bundled in showroom pricing.

Delivery and Installation Considerations

Delivery and installation are crucial parts of the cabinet buying experience, and how these services are handled differs depending on where you buy.

Local Showroom:

  • Delivery handled by in-house team or local partners.

  • May offer assembly and installation as part of a package.

  • Faster turnaround for nearby locations.

Online Retailer:

  • Cabinets typically arrive flat-packed or RTA (Ready to Assemble).

  • Delivery handled by third-party logistics companies.

  • Customers are responsible for hiring local installers or assembling themselves.

Customers who are not DIY-savvy may benefit more from the full-service offerings of a local showroom.

Evaluating Credibility and Authenticity of Retailers

Because Forevermark Cabinets are popular and often sold through third-party platforms, buyers must be cautious of unauthorized or untrustworthy sellers—especially online. Not every retailer advertising Forevermark Cabinets is officially licensed or authorized, which can lead to quality or warranty issues.

Tips for Verifying a Retailer:

  • Check the Official Forevermark Website: Use the dealer locator to find authorized sellers.

  • Ask for Proof: Reputable dealers can show their authorization status or provide a dealer code.

  • Read Reviews: Look for consistent, authentic customer feedback on service and delivery.

  • Inquire About Warranty: Only authorized dealers can honor Forevermark’s limited warranty.

Ensuring the legitimacy of the seller protects you from counterfeits, second-hand products, or unsupported purchases that won’t be backed by the brand.
